Solving a Century-Old Mystery
In 2002 and 2003, Perelman posted a series of papers online that effectively proved the Poincaré Conjecture. This conjecture, formulated in 1904 by Henri Poincaré, is a central problem in topology, the study of geometric shapes. It deals with the fundamental nature of three-dimensional spaces and helps us understand the potential shape of our universe. For a century, the world's top mathematical minds tried and failed to solve it. Perelman's breakthrough completely revolutionized the field, solving a problem that had baffled mathematicians for over a century.
Refusing the Fields Medal
In 2006, Perelman was awarded the Fields Medal, widely considered the "Nobel Prize of Mathematics." Despite this prestigious recognition, Perelman refused to accept it. His reason for refusing the award was deeply personal: he stated, "I’m not interested in money or fame; I don’t want to be on display like an animal in a zoo." This decision made him the first and only person in history to reject this prestigious award, highlighting his disinterest in the public recognition that typically accompanies such achievements.
Declining the $1,000,000 Clay Prize
In 2000, the Clay Mathematics Institute named the seven most difficult mathematical problems of the millennium and put a $1,000,000 bounty on each. The Poincaré Conjecture was one of them. When the institute officially offered Perelman the prize in 2010, he again turned it down. He explained that he felt the decision was unfair, stating that his contribution to solving the problem was no greater than that of Richard Hamilton, an American mathematician whose earlier work Perelman had built upon. This decision further emphasized his commitment to intellectual integrity over personal gain.
A Life in Retirement
After his groundbreaking work, Perelman chose to quit professional mathematics entirely. He withdrew from the public eye and moved into a modest apartment in St. Petersburg, Russia, where he reportedly lives a very simple, reclusive life with his mother. His decision to step away from the field and the public spotlight is a striking contrast to the typical trajectory of a brilliant mathematician.
